A historic church in South End has entered a new chapter as the home of the Levine Museum of the New South.
Why it matters: While renovations for the site at the corner of East and South boulevards are years away, the space is already being activated as a community hub.
Catch up quick: The museum bought the .57-acre Grace Covenant Church property at 1800 South Blvd. earlier this year for $7.5 million…
